What Is Regulatory Compliance in International Trade?

Regulatory compliance means following all laws, regulations, and agency requirements that apply to your products when they cross international borders. In the United States, trade regulations are enforced by agencies such as U.S. Customs and Border Protection (CBP). In Canada, oversight is managed by the Canada Border Services Agency (CBSA).

Depending on the type of goods, additional government departments may also require permits, certifications, or inspections.
